Systems and methods for mounting photographic equipment
09835934 · 2017-12-05 · ·

An apparatus is provided comprising a shaft having an axis and mounted to a boom structure, a support structure configured to be coupled to the shaft, wherein the support structure is configured to rotate about the axis. In addition, a method is provided comprising translating a cradle along a vertical axis, and rotating, in response to the translating, a support structure about a shaft, wherein the cradle is supported by the support structure, wherein the cradle remains stationary with regard to pitch rotation during the translating.

Context based target framing in a teleconferencing environment

A method for determining camera framing in a teleconferencing system comprises a process loop which includes acquiring an audio-visual frame from a captured a video data frame; detecting objects and extracting image features of the objects within the video data frame, ingesting the audio-visual frame into a context-based audio-visual map in an intelligent manner, and selecting targets from within the map for inclusion in an audio-video stream for transmission to a remote endpoint.

METHOD AND SYSTEM FOR DATACASTING AND CONTENT MANAGEMENT

A method and system for datacasting and content management. Such a system may have, as its core, a dashboard system for managing data feeds. A dashboard system may receive data feeds from one or more associated devices, such as the hardware devices of first responders or other public safety officers, and may aggregate and prioritize them. The dashboard system may then manage, prioritize and encrypt the video, files and other data in preparation for broadcast over the television or satellite transmitter, via, for example, a television broadcasting station, and may then broadcast the video, files, or other data to a plurality of users. Alerts and notifications may be created, files attached and links to video streams distributed over this same broadcast network. The broadcasting system may be able to send multiple streams of content simultaneously, may be able to target specific users to be broadcast to, and may be able to incorporate data from public data sources, such as public security cameras.

INFORMATION PROCESSING APPARATUS, INFORMATION PROCESSING METHOD THEREFOR, AND COMPUTER-READABLE STORAGE MEDIUM
20220060657 · 2022-02-24 ·

An information processing apparatus, the information processing apparatus executing an information processing method comprising: receiving a request of image data from an external terminal; specifying, based on the request, a vehicle that provides image capturing data to generate the image data; specifying a parameter concerning a communication path to be used by the specified vehicle to transmit the image capturing data to the information processing apparatus; and transmitting the specified parameter to the specified vehicle.

INDUCTIVELY POWER CAMERA
20230179025 · 2023-06-08 ·

An inductively powered camera device including a housing including a base portion configured to be mounted to an exterior surface of a window of a vehicle, a camera supported by the housing and configured to collect image data, an inductive power pad supported by the housing, the inductive power pad in electrical communication with the camera and configured to provide power to the camera, and an inductive power puck configured to be mounted to an interior surface of the window, the inductive power puck configured to inductively provide power to the inductive power pad through the window of the vehicle.

Video conference system

Embodiments of the disclosure provided herein can be used to improve the control, selection and transmission of data to a remote video conferencing environment, by use of a plurality of wired or wirelessly connected electronic devices. In one example, the transmission of data from a local environment can be improved by switching the source of visual inputs (e.g., cameras or display of an electronic device, such as laptop) and/or audio inputs (e.g., microphones) to the one or more appropriate visual and audio sources available within the local environment. The most appropriate visual and audio sources can be the sources that provide the participants in the remote environment the most relevant data giving the remote users the best understanding of the current activities in the local environment.
